Wilderness and the American Spirit is a gripping exploration of the American spirit and our relationship to the environment that blends science, history, cultural criticism, and storytelling through the myths and stories of the American West along the Applegate Trail. The book tells a story of expansion of a nation across the continent illuminating the path we took to arrive here, in the 21st century, at the forward edge of environmental catastrophe and consequence. Told through stories of the first American emigrants who traveled west to the present day. These are stories of consumption, wealth and power that illuminate the American relationship to the environment and this storytelling model is a basis for new environmental thinking.
